Abstract

The utility model relates to the field of garden engineering, in particular to a garden pesticide spraying device, which comprises a base capable of moving left and right, wherein a stirring tank is fixedly arranged above the base, a feeding hole is formed in the left part of the top wall of the stirring tank, a first motor is arranged in the middle of the top wall of the stirring tank, the output end of the first motor is connected with a rotating shaft which is vertically arranged in the stirring tank, a plurality of stirring shafts are arranged on the circumference of the rotating shaft, a water pump is arranged on the right part of the top wall of the stirring tank, an input port of the water pump is connected with a water inlet pipe which is arranged in the stirring tank, an output port of the water pump is connected with one ends of two water outlet pipes which are arranged on the outer side of the stirring tank, two first spray heads are respectively connected with the other ends of the two water outlet pipes, a first support plate is arranged on the right side of the stirring tank on the base, and a swinging mechanism which can drive the first spray heads to move forwards and backwards is arranged above the first support plate. The device can realize automatic mobile spraying to the lawn, and spraying height is adjustable, need not manual stirring.

Technical Field
The utility model relates to the field of garden engineering, in particular to a garden pesticide spraying device.
Background
In lawn greening, plant diseases and insect pests are common problems, which can seriously affect the beautiful appearance and health of greening, and common diseases and insect pests include aphids, spiders, powdery mildew and the like. Therefore, the lawn greening needs to be properly controlled. Among them, spraying is a common prevention and control measure. The pesticide spraying can effectively prevent and treat various diseases and insect pests, protect the health of plants and maintain the ecological environment of parks.
In the existing medicine spraying device, in the medicine spraying process, a water pipe is required to be manually held by a person to move back and forth for spraying medicine, so that the workload is increased, and the operation time of workers is long and the workers are easy to be tired; in addition, the medicine and the water are mixed manually, so that the stirring effect is poor and a large amount of manpower is consumed; the existing spraying device does not adjust the spraying height, and cannot adapt to spraying of lawns with different heights.
Based on the problems, the applicant develops a garden pesticide spraying device, and the device can realize automatic mobile pesticide spraying to a lawn, and the pesticide spraying height is adjustable without manual stirring.

Referring to fig. 1, the utility model discloses a garden pesticide spraying device, which comprises a base 1 capable of moving left and right, wherein a group of universal wheels 27 are arranged on the left side of the bottom of the base, so that the device is more labor-saving when turning, and a group of fixed wheels 28 are arranged on the right side of the base, so that the device is more stable when advancing; the left end of the base 1 is fixedly provided with an arc handle 2, the upper part is fixedly provided with a stirring box 3, the left part of the top wall of the stirring box 3 is provided with a feeding port 4, the middle position is provided with a first motor 5, medicines and water can be fed from the feeding port 4, the output end of the first motor 5 is connected with a rotating shaft 6 which is vertically arranged in the stirring box 3, the circumference of the rotating shaft 6 is provided with a plurality of stirring shafts 7, preferably, the stirring shafts 7 are in a round bar shape, four groups of stirring shafts 6 are uniformly arranged around the rotating shaft 6, and a plurality of stirring shafts 7 are sequentially arranged at equal intervals from the top end to the bottom end of the rotating shaft 6; the right part of the top wall of the stirring tank 3 is provided with a water pump 8, an input port of the water pump 8 is connected with a water inlet pipe 9, the water inlet pipe 9 is positioned at the edge of the stirring tank 3 and is prevented from interfering with a stirring shaft 7, an output port of the water pump 8 is connected with one ends of two water outlet pipes 10 positioned at the outer side of the stirring tank 3, the other ends of the two water outlet pipes 10 are respectively connected with two first spray heads 11, a first support plate 13 is arranged above the base 1 and positioned at the right side of the stirring tank 3, and a swinging mechanism capable of driving the first spray heads 11 to move forwards and backwards is arranged above the first support plate 13, so that the two first spray heads 11 can uniformly spray liquid medicine.
As a further explanation of this embodiment, referring to fig. 2-3, the swinging mechanism includes a second support plate 14 mounted above a first support plate 13 and horizontally disposed in the left-right direction, a support frame 16 hinged above the second support plate 14 by a cylinder 15, an inner groove 17 formed in the middle of the support frame 16 in the longitudinal direction, the inner groove 17 penetrating the support frame 16, a rotating wheel 18 having a vertically disposed central shaft rotatably mounted on the middle top of the second support plate 14, a first stop pin 19 mounted near the edge of the rotating wheel 18 and slidable in the inner groove 17 of the support frame 16, preferably, the first stop pin 19 is cylindrical, vertically disposed on the rotating wheel 18 and extends outside the support frame 16, the central shaft of the rotating wheel 18 is dynamically connected with a second motor 20, the second motor 20 is fixedly mounted on a support plate extending from the first support plate 13, a slide rail 21 horizontally disposed in the front-rear direction is mounted on the right side of the second support plate 14, a slide 22 is slidably mounted in the slide rail 21, the left and right sides of the slide rail 21 are respectively extended in the left-right sides of the slide 22, two first nozzles 11 are respectively fixedly mounted at both ends of the slide 22 in the direction, the middle of the slide 22 is mounted at the middle top of the slide 22, and the middle position above the slide 22 is provided with a second stop pin 23 which is slidably disposed at the right end of the second end of the support frame 16 and is preferably, and is extended outside the slide pin 23. Preferably, when the slider 22 moves to the leftmost side, the right end of the slider 22 can extend out of the slide rail 21, so as to avoid interference between the first nozzle 11 and the slide rail 21; when the slider 22 moves to the rightmost side, the left end of the slider 22 can extend out of the slide rail 21, so that the first nozzle 11 is prevented from interfering with the slide rail 21.
As a further explanation of this embodiment, referring to fig. 4, the bottom of the slide rail 21 is provided with a long slot 24 along the length direction, and a second nozzle 29 capable of passing through the long slot 24 is installed at the middle position of the bottom of the slide block 22, and the second nozzle 29 is downward and is communicated with one of the water outlet pipes 10. The sliding block 22 slides reciprocally in the sliding rail 21, so as to drive the second spray head 29 to spray medicine evenly along the sliding direction.
As a further explanation of this embodiment, referring to fig. 2 to 3, the upper end of the first stop pin 19 is provided with a first limit catch 25 for preventing the first stop pin 19 from coming out of the inner groove 17, and the first limit catch 25 is disc-shaped and can be engaged with the support frame 16.
As a further explanation of this embodiment, referring to fig. 2 to 3, the end of the second stop pin 23 is provided with a second limit catch 26 for preventing the second stop pin 23 from coming out of the inner groove 17, and the second limit catch 26 is disc-shaped and can be engaged with the support frame 16.
As a further explanation of the present embodiment, referring to fig. 1, a cylinder 12 for adjusting the height of the swing mechanism is installed at the bottom of the first support plate 13.
Working principle: firstly, medicine and water are put into a stirring box 3 from a feed port 4, a first motor 5 is started, a rotating shaft 6 drives a stirring shaft 7 to rotate for stirring, the medicine and the water are fully mixed into medicine liquid, then an arc handle 2 is used for pushing a medicine spraying device to a lawn area where the medicine liquid needs to be sprayed, after a starting cylinder 12 lifts a swinging mechanism to a proper position, a second motor 20 is started, a rotating wheel 18 starts to rotate, a first stop pin 19 on the rotating wheel 18 also rotates along with the swinging mechanism, the first stop pin 19 can slide in an inner groove 17 of a supporting frame 16, so that the supporting frame 16 can swing back and forth around a central shaft of the rotating wheel 18, and as a second stop pin 23 on a sliding block 22 can slide at the end part of the inner groove 17 of the supporting frame 16, the supporting frame 16 can drive the sliding block 22 to slide back and forth along the sliding rail 21, and further drive a first spray head 11 at two ends and a second spray head 29 at the bottom to slide back and forth along the sliding rail 21, at the moment, the water pump 8 starts to work, the stirred medicine liquid is sucked into a water outlet pipe 10 from a water inlet pipe 9, and finally the medicine liquid is sprayed out through three spray heads.
